What You’ll Do
- Maintain accurate financial records, including accounts payable and receivable.
- Oversee bank reconciliations, ensuring all transactions are properly recorded.
- Manage VAT returns and liaise with HMRC and equivalent bodies in Ireland, Germany, and Spain.
- Support month-end and year-end close processes.
- Assist in preparing management reports and financial statements.
- Work closely with external accountants in the UK, Chile, and Australia.
- Implement and improve financial controls and processes to support business growth.
- Support payroll operations and employee expense processing.
- Monitor cash flow and provide financial insights.
